Bulgaria - Total Post-Secondary Education School Age Population
Since 2014, Bulgaria Total Post-Secondary Education School Age Population decreased by 3.9% year on year. With 119,729 Persons in 2019, the country was number 76 comparing other countries in Total Post-Secondary Education School Age Population. Bulgaria is overtaken by Belgium, which was number 75 with 129,720 Persons and is followed by Jamaica at 114,000 Persons. India lead the ranking with 48,083,290 Persons in 2014, an increase of 0.8% compared to 2013. China, Pakistan and Bangladesh resp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Pakistan witnessed the best average annual growth at +25% per year, while Azerbaijan recorded the worst performance at -47.7% per year.
